IN RE SIMPSON


32 N.J. Super. 85 (1954)

107 A.2d 827

IN THE MATTER OF THE ESTATE OF MARY ELIZABETH SIMPSON, DECEASED.

Superior Court of New Jersey, Hudson County Court, Probate Division.

Decided September 13, 1954.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Mr. Harold Grouls, attorney for the exceptant.

Mr. William E. Decker and Mr. John I. O'Neil, attorneys for the executors.


DUFFY, J.C.C.

Mary Elizabeth Simpson, a resident of Hudson County, died on November 20, 1952. Her last will and testament was probated in the surrogate's court on December 10, 1952. The executors, Harvey B. Nelson and Sally Ward Howe, now present their final account for approval.
